Visionbody covers the system in three tiers rather than one blanket period: three years on the PowerBox, six months or 100 wash cycles on the suit's functional components, and 30 days on the textile. Returns run 21 days from delivery, not the 30 days on one of their own marketing cards.

The three tiers, side by side

All three clocks start on the ship date.

Part Cover What it includes
PowerBox 3 year limited warranty Wireless Bluetooth controller, all 12 channels
PowerSuit functional components 6 months, maximum 100 wash cycles Electrodes, wiring, connection plate
PowerSuit textile 30 days The garment: fabric, seams, closures

Three years on the PowerBox is the tier that counts

If you remember one line from this page, make it this one. The PowerBox is the wireless controller that runs the session over Bluetooth and drives all 12 channels, and it is backed for three full years. That matters more than the number suggests, because the PowerBox is not sold separately on any of the three storefronts and has no standalone replacement price anywhere.

The battery ships as its own item in the box rather than sealed inside the controller: an LP-E10 cell, about six hours per charge, recharged over USB-C, user replaceable and Canon LP-E10 compatible at 7.4V and 900 to 1100 mAh. Visionbody sells no batteries. Their guidance is that US replacements are widely available, Amazon included, and that in Switzerland they source from Patona.

Six months or 100 washes is a warranty limit, not a lifespan

Electrodes, wiring and the connection plate are covered for six months or 100 wash cycles, whichever comes first. Read that 100 correctly: it is the ceiling on the guarantee, not a durability rating.

Run it against Visionbody's own care advice, because this is the part buyers miss. They ask you to wash after every two to three sessions, and the protocol is two to three sessions a week. Cycles stack up faster than people picture when they hear "100", and a buyer following that guidance to the letter can approach 100 washes well inside the suit's usable life. The cap can arrive while the garment is still perfectly good.

So use months one to six to shake out any electrode, wiring or connection plate fault, and treat the wash counter as real: conductive fabric is a consumable in a way a controller is not. Washing it the way the warranty expects

Care is where the shorter tiers get won. Machine wash cold on a gentle cycle at 800 rpm spin, inside the laundry net from the box, every Velcro fastening closed, mild bleach-free detergent (gentle baby detergent works best). The control box never goes in with it.

One thing people reliably get backwards: do not turn the suit inside out to wash it. Inside out is the post-workout air-drying position, a separate step. Dry flat, away from open flame or high heat.

The prohibited list: no hand washing, dry cleaning, drying in direct sunlight, sports detergents, fabric softener, bleach, tumble drying, ironing or wringing out. Salt from sweat weakens conductivity, which is why the wash schedule exists. Our setup guide covers the routine around it.

Check the fit inside 21 days, not 30

The textile tier runs 30 days, but do not let that number set your schedule: the refund window closes 21 days after delivery. Inspect the garment in week one, seams, Velcro, connection plate, and how it sits through the shoulders and thighs. There is no size chart because Visionbody emails you for measurements after you order, so confirm they got it right while a return is still available.

Returns run 21 days, and one Visionbody page disagrees

The return window is 21 days from delivery. Ask support for a Return Authorization number inside that window first, because a parcel sent back without one creates a problem nobody enjoys solving. You cover return shipping unless the fault is Visionbody's, and the refund lands within 14 business days of inspection.

Better from us than on day 27: Visionbody's financing page advertises a "30-Day Money-Back" guarantee and calls the warranty two years. Both are wrong against the policy pages, which govern. Diarise day 14 and you decide with a week in hand.

Registration, proof of purchase and the 10 day claim clock

  • The clocks start at ship date. Not delivery, not first use.
  • Registration is required. Do it the week your suit arrives, while the order email is findable.
  • Keep proof of purchase. The invoice in the box is what you will be asked for, so photograph it.
  • Claims go in within 10 calendar days of the return. Start the paperwork the day you ship it back.
  • Complimentary gifts are not covered. Treat a promotional extra as a bonus, not a warranted component.

Support and buying from outside the US

There are three storefronts rather than one global store, and the one you land on sets your currency and the company on your invoice. visionbody.com serves the US in dollars, run by VB USA LLC in Miami. visionbody.eu serves the rest of Europe in euros, with GB visitors routed there. visionbodyshop.com serves Germany, Austria and Switzerland, run by Visionbody Europe LLC in Mallorca.

On support we will only give you what Visionbody publishes. The US address is support-usa@visionbody.com. We found no published EU or DACH support address, and Visionbody does not state which entity administers a claim raised outside the US, so if you order on visionbody.eu or visionbodyshop.com, use that storefront's contact route and get the process confirmed in writing before you need it.

Two more notes for buyers abroad. Batteries cannot ship to the UK, Arabian countries, Africa, Asia or Russia, so owners there source the LP-E10 cell locally, and Visionbody publishes availability guidance for the US and Switzerland only. Customs, duties and import VAT fall to the buyer, as our shipping guide explains. Payment plans are a US-only arrangement, so plan to pay in full at checkout.

How the cover compares with the rest of the category

System Controller cover Garment cover FDA 510(k)
Visionbody 3 years (PowerBox) 6 months or 100 washes on functional parts, 30 days textile K222386, cleared as substantially equivalent to a legally marketed device
TitanBody 3 years (powerbox) 1 year None we could find
Katalyst Not stated in sources we checked Not stated in sources we checked K171035 and K181199, same substantial equivalence basis

TitanBody's year on the garment reads better than six months. Weigh it against the rest: it launched in September 2025 with about 15 Trustpilot reviews, so no long-term feedback exists on how that year gets honoured. Its site claims FDA clearance but publishes no number, and we searched the 510(k) database under TitanBody and its known parent names without finding a record. A clearance could exist under a name we did not find, so ask them for it. Our side by side has the rest.

Visionbody's number is public and checkable: 510(k) K222386, applicant Vb Technologies AG, decided 24 February 2023, where the FDA found the device substantially equivalent to a device already legally marketed. That is what FDA cleared means: a real regulatory review, not the same as approval, and not proof of any fitness result. Katalyst is cleared too, under K171035 and K181199, though it costs $2,999 plus a mandatory $35 to $49 per month subscription and runs on iOS only.
